Hotel Description

Point A London, Liverpool Street is a modern budget hotel located in the heart of one of London's most vibrant and artsy areas. Situated at 13-15 Folgate Street, London E1 6BX, this hotel offers guests easy access to the bustling Brick Lane, renowned for its curry restaurants, trendy bars, shops, and the popular Spitalfields Market. The hotel’s prime location places it within walking distance of Liverpool Street Station, one of the city’s major transportation hubs, making it an ideal choice for travelers seeking both convenience and a lively local atmosphere. The redbrick building housing Point A London, Liverpool Street is simple yet stylish, with a focus on functionality and comfort. The rooms, while compact, offer a straightforward and clean design, providing guests with everything they need for a pleasant stay. Some rooms feature windows, while others are windowless, offering varying levels of privacy and quietness for different guest preferences. All rooms come with essential amenities like Wi-Fi access, flat-screen TVs, and safes, which are available for a surcharge. Guests can also take advantage of the hotel’s various additional services, including towel rentals and baggage storage. The hotel’s front desk is available for guest assistance, and housekeeping ensures the rooms are kept in pristine condition during your stay. While the property does not feature high-end amenities such as a fitness center or spa, it offers a practical and budget-friendly experience for travelers. For breakfast, guests can enjoy a continental breakfast and a breakfast buffet, which have received positive mentions from previous guests. Great location and fairly priced for where it is.. however its really limited. For example there are no cups, glasses kettle or tea coffee.. there are no seats in the room and the toilet in the bathroom is directly behind the end of your bed. It reminded me of a student dorm more than a hotel room. The continental breakfast was nice and wide choice

To start with, the location and price of the hotel was excellent, and far cheaper than anything else I could find, even compared to travelodge etc.The double room was comfortable, clean and had a big window which was nice, I believe some rooms are inside and don't have any daylight.However the room was very hot, despite having air conditioning, this didn't seem to make much difference. The walls between adjoining rooms are very very thin and have almost no sound insulation.Also the rooms are very compact, meaning they can cram in lots and charge less - no problem for us, but for anyone on the larger side you will struggle to move around the room.Check in and out is 100% self service and rooms are serviced after 3 nights, so very little human interaction.
